Output 84b13204d2e097118c02b86500ff01f1b378ca0f918366966b172d7798a90417:2

value
169839988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130df00457cabe0f847619041027fe840089e87a OP_EQUAL
address
33RmTb2z4AbUsnHwYSGdskTaoQXqS4BEMQ
transaction
84b13204d2e097118c02b86500ff01f1b378ca0f918366966b172d7798a90417
spent
true